RDS 552 - Cariology
This course is designed to give students a strong background in cariology. At the end of the course, students should have a profound knowledge of cariology and be able to:
- Discuss the history and theories of the aetiology of dental caries.
- Identify and describe the role of oral microflora, diet and dental deposits in the pathogenesis of the disease.
- Describe the histopathology and diagnosis of dental caries.
- Discuss the epidemiology of dental caries, including the selective sites for caries attack and special population groups at risk for the disease.
- Identify the various caries activity tests and evaluate their role in caries prediction.
- Discuss the various preventive measures for dental caries.
- Outline the steps in the therapeutic management of dental caries.
